Offline programming is wherever the whole cell, the robot and each of the machines or instruments within the workspace are mapped graphically. The robot can then be moved on monitor and the method simulated. A robotics simulator is utilized to build embedded applications for your robot, devoid of depending upon the physical operation from the robot arm and conclude effector.

Smaller sized robot arms frequently use superior speed, very low torque DC motors, which normally require substantial gearing ratios; this has the drawback of backlash. In these types of conditions the harmonic generate is usually employed.

For example, if a robot picks a screw by its head, the screw might be in a random angle. A subsequent attempt to insert the screw into a hole could easily are unsuccessful. These and very similar situations can be enhanced with 'guide-ins' e.g. by building the doorway to the outlet tapered.

An autonomous robot is actually a robot that acts with no recourse to human Manage. The very first autonomous robots were being often called Elmer and Elsie and produced from the late nineteen forties by W. Grey Walter. They had been the initial robots which were programmed to "Imagine" just how biological brains do, intended to have absolutely free will.

Industrial robots perform intricate welds with precision and velocity. Mechanized protocols for arc and spot welding popularized while in the nineteen eighties, in hopes to save employees from burns and inhaling carcinogenic fumes, and has because remained commonplace within the automotive and construction industries.
